A Nasik court on Friday granted police custody for 36-year-old Hindu monk Dayanad Pandey on charges of conspiring in Malegaon blast in September 2006 that killed five people. The court also allowed the police to put the suspect through truth tests. Maharashtra state's Anti-Terrorism Squad has so far arrested ten suspects including Hindu God-woman Pragya Singh in connection with the September 29 Malegaon blast case.
